Transaction 905aad84fcdcf5037b28391df464977f3770163c3def60b2253ff417f91e5687

1 Input
2 Outputs
  • 905aad84fcdcf5037b28391df464977f3770163c3def60b2253ff417f91e5687:0
  • value  40000
    address  3LfPt1z7fiWNgYHktMrhGZnDZ15YJjNp7p
  • 905aad84fcdcf5037b28391df464977f3770163c3def60b2253ff417f91e5687:1
  • value  9312046
    address  177AH6sgCWT6vwQFzTAv7Di8XHUvGeD7tF